Qantas flights to US, UK unlikely to go ahead by July, experts say – ABC News
Qantas opening up flights to the US and UK is an optimistic move to remain competitive and secure bookings, aviation experts warn, with London or New York-bound…
Travellers shouldn’t bank on a flight to London in the next six months, analysts say, despite Qantas bringing forward its international bookings.
Key points:
- Aviation experts say Qantas opening up flights to the US and UK is a bid to stay competitive
- Deputy Prime Minister Michael McCormack slammed Qantas’s move and said the Government would make any decisions regarding international travel
- Qantas says it stands by its comments last year indicating anyone flying internationally would need to be vaccinated…
